Output 0ef690ca858db20ae0ece902eb93f959096a566349787865e3a0b2c7ef1e8e74:0

value
96379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e2733d1043cc6bcda7472d875a66ccde685021 OP_EQUAL
address
39LZHVqRwuxHx4L9uJD6mEwJzcC7pmcYx6
transaction
0ef690ca858db20ae0ece902eb93f959096a566349787865e3a0b2c7ef1e8e74
confirmations
310582
spent
true